What is the difference between It's great! and That's great! ?Feel free to just provide example sentences.

If you were talking about a personal experience, for example you got a new job and you were talking about it- you would say "it's great!" But if someone else was telling you something that they did, you would say "that's great!"

Itâs great is a general statement. Itâs great to be home again. Itâs great you passed the exam.
Thatâs great is more emphatic and specific. Thatâs great. Well done on passing the exam.
Thatâs great to hear youâve arrived home.
In short, there is little difference in meaning, merely emphasis and specificity.
